nr_cpu_ids is dependent only on cpu_possible_map and
setup_per_cpu_areas() already depends on cpu_possible_map and will use
nr_cpu_ids.  Initialize nr_cpu_ids before setting up percpu areas.

These two patches fix boot failure on sparc64 which happens if the
cpus don't have consecutive cpu numbers.
